.arrowLink.svelte-14mo9oo{gap:.2rem;margin-left:auto;display:flex}.arrowLink.svelte-14mo9oo .arrowIcon:where(.svelte-14mo9oo){transform:translateY(.1rem)}.arrowLink.svelte-14mo9oo:hover .arrowIcon:where(.svelte-14mo9oo){color:var(--color-secondary);transition:all .2s ease-in-out;transform:translate(.1rem)}#arrowUnderline.svelte-14mo9oo{z-index:20;font-size:1rem;position:relative}#arrowUnderline.svelte-14mo9oo:after{content:"";z-index:-1;opacity:.5;background:linear-gradient(65deg, var(--color-secondary) 0%, var(--color-secondary) 100%, #ffd10000 100%);border-radius:2px;width:102%;height:30%;transition:all .2s ease-in-out;position:absolute;bottom:10%;left:-1%}#arrowUnderline.svelte-14mo9oo:hover:after{height:80%}@media (width>=55em){#arrowUnderline.svelte-14mo9oo{font-size:1.1rem}}.info.svelte-19ysxpo{flex-direction:column;align-items:flex-start;gap:1rem;display:flex}.details.svelte-19ysxpo{flex-direction:column;display:flex}.details.svelte-19ysxpo span:where(.svelte-19ysxpo){color:var(--color-lightgray)}.category.svelte-19ysxpo{order:2;font-size:.85rem}@media (width>=55em){.info.svelte-19ysxpo{flex-direction:row;justify-content:space-between;align-items:center;display:flex}.category.svelte-19ysxpo{order:1;font-size:1rem}}section.svelte-1xuh14r{color:#fff;width:100%;margin-top:5rem;transition:background-color 1s;position:relative}h1.svelte-1xuh14r{color:#0000;opacity:1;background:#0000 -webkit-gradient(linear, left top, right top, from(var(--color-secondary)), color-stop(var(--color-primary))) repeat scroll 0% 0%/200% 200%;background:#0000 linear-gradient(125deg, var(--color-secondary), var(--color-primary)) repeat scroll 0% 0%/200% 200%;background-clip:border-box;-webkit-background-clip:text;background-clip:text;font-size:2em;font-weight:700;line-height:1.2em;text-decoration:none;animation:3s infinite svelte-1xuh14r-GradientAnimation}@keyframes svelte-1xuh14r-GradientAnimation{0%{background-position:0%}50%{background-position:100%}to{background-position:0%}}h4.svelte-1xuh14r{line-height:1.5rem}.svg-bg.svelte-1xuh14r{opacity:.4;width:100%;transition:all .75s;position:absolute;inset:-25% 0 0}.hero.svelte-1xuh14r>:where(.svelte-1xuh14r)+:where(.svelte-1xuh14r){margin-top:1.5rem}.hero.svelte-1xuh14r{width:100%}@keyframes svelte-1xuh14r-wiggle{0%{transform:translateY(-10%)}50%{transform:translateY(25%)}to{transform:translateY(-10%)}}@media screen and (width>=55em){h1.svelte-1xuh14r{font-size:5em}h4.svelte-1xuh14r{line-height:2.5rem}.hero.svelte-1xuh14r{width:100%;margin:auto}.hero.svelte-1xuh14r>:where(.svelte-1xuh14r)+:where(.svelte-1xuh14r){margin-top:2.5rem}.svg-bg.svelte-1xuh14r{width:100%;top:-50%}}@media screen and (width>=75em){.hero.svelte-1xuh14r{width:80%;margin:auto}.svg-bg.svelte-1xuh14r{top:-70%}}@media (width>=100em){.svg-bg.svelte-1xuh14r{top:-85%}}h3.svelte-t1qzd5{color:var(--color-secondary);margin-bottom:.2rem;font-weight:500}img.svelte-t1qzd5{object-fit:cover;transform:translateZ(0);backface-visibility:hidden;border-radius:100%;width:4rem;height:4rem;margin-bottom:0;display:block;overflow:hidden;-webkit-transform:translate(0,0)}.picture.svelte-t1qzd5{flex-direction:row;align-items:center;column-gap:1rem;display:flex}.picture.svelte-t1qzd5 span:where(.svelte-t1qzd5){font-size:.9rem}.icons.svelte-t1qzd5{flex-wrap:wrap;gap:1.5rem;display:flex}.info.svelte-t1qzd5{background-color:var(--color-gray);box-sizing:border-box;width:100%;color:var(--color-white);z-index:auto;border-radius:12px;padding:1.5rem 2rem;position:relative}.info.svelte-t1qzd5:before{content:"";border:2px solid var(--color-secondary);box-sizing:border-box;pointer-events:none;border-radius:12px;width:100%;height:100%;display:block;position:absolute;top:0;left:0;transform:translate(.5rem,-.5rem)}.info-grid.svelte-t1qzd5{grid-template-columns:1fr;gap:1.5rem;display:grid}.grid-item.svelte-t1qzd5{margin:auto;position:relative}.mobile.svelte-t1qzd5{display:flex}.desktop.svelte-t1qzd5{display:none}@media (width>=55em){h3.svelte-t1qzd5{margin-bottom:.5rem}img.svelte-t1qzd5{object-fit:cover;transform:translateZ(0);backface-visibility:hidden;border-radius:100%;width:5.5rem;height:5.5rem;margin-bottom:1.5rem;display:block;overflow:hidden;-webkit-transform:translate(0,0)}.info-grid.svelte-t1qzd5{grid-template-columns:1fr 1fr;gap:2rem}.picture.svelte-t1qzd5{flex-direction:column;align-items:flex-start}.picture.svelte-t1qzd5 span:where(.svelte-t1qzd5){font-size:1rem}.info.svelte-t1qzd5{padding:3rem}.info.svelte-t1qzd5:before{transform:translate(1rem,-1rem)}.icons.svelte-t1qzd5{width:75%}.desktop.svelte-t1qzd5{display:flex}.mobile.svelte-t1qzd5{display:none}}section.svelte-qjbz3f{width:100%;height:100%;color:var(--color-white);transition:all 1s cubic-bezier(.07,.95,0,1);position:relative}a.svelte-qjbz3f{z-index:20;font-size:1rem;position:relative}a.svelte-qjbz3f:after{content:"";z-index:-1;opacity:.5;background:linear-gradient(65deg, var(--color-secondary) 0%, var(--color-secondary) 100%, #ffd10000 100%);border-radius:2px;width:102%;height:30%;transition:all .2s ease-in-out;position:absolute;bottom:10%;left:-1%}a.svelte-qjbz3f:hover:after{height:80%}.grid.svelte-qjbz3f{flex-direction:column;justify-content:center;align-items:center;gap:1.5rem;height:100%;display:flex}.grid.svelte-qjbz3f p:where(.svelte-qjbz3f){margin-bottom:1rem}.description.svelte-qjbz3f{width:100%}.description.svelte-qjbz3f>:where(.svelte-qjbz3f)+:where(.svelte-qjbz3f){margin-top:1rem}.icons.svelte-qjbz3f{display:none}@media (width>=55em){a.svelte-qjbz3f{font-size:1.2rem}.grid.svelte-qjbz3f{grid-template-columns:1fr 1fr;gap:4rem;display:grid}.grid.svelte-qjbz3f p:where(.svelte-qjbz3f){margin-bottom:1.5rem}.description.svelte-qjbz3f>:where(.svelte-qjbz3f)+:where(.svelte-qjbz3f){margin-top:2rem}.icons.svelte-qjbz3f{flex-wrap:wrap;gap:1.5rem;display:flex}}section.svelte-popoh1{width:100%;height:100%;color:var(--color-white);transition:all 1s cubic-bezier(.07,.95,0,1);position:relative}h2.svelte-popoh1{margin-bottom:1rem}ul.svelte-popoh1{margin:0}.projects-link.svelte-popoh1{margin-left:auto}.grid.svelte-popoh1{flex-direction:column;justify-content:center;gap:1.5rem;height:100%;display:flex}.description.svelte-popoh1{align-items:center;display:flex}.projects.svelte-popoh1{z-index:1;gap:1rem;margin:auto;position:relative}@media (width>=55em){h2.svelte-popoh1{margin-bottom:3rem}.projects.svelte-popoh1{flex-flow:wrap;justify-content:center;gap:3rem;display:flex}.projects-link.svelte-popoh1{margin-top:1rem}}section.svelte-2r6tp5{background-color:var(--color-gray);border-radius:12px;width:100%;margin:2rem auto}label.svelte-2r6tp5{color:var(--color-lightgray)}form.svelte-2r6tp5{width:90%;margin:auto}form.svelte-2r6tp5>:where(.svelte-2r6tp5)+:where(.svelte-2r6tp5){margin-top:1.5rem}.field.svelte-2r6tp5>:where(.svelte-2r6tp5)+:where(.svelte-2r6tp5){margin-top:.75rem}.container.svelte-2r6tp5{border-radius:8px;margin:auto;padding:3rem 0}.form-input.svelte-2r6tp5{box-sizing:border-box;color:var(--color-white);background-color:var(--color-black);border:#0000;border-radius:4px;outline:none;width:100%;height:2rem;padding:.5rem 1rem;font-size:1rem;transition:border-color .3s ease-in-out}.form-input.svelte-2r6tp5:focus{box-shadow:0 0 0 3px var(--color-primary)}.message.svelte-2r6tp5{padding-bottom:5rem;font-family:Rubik Variable,sans-serif}.error-message.svelte-2r6tp5{color:red}.success-message.svelte-2r6tp5{color:var(--color-primary)}.hidden.svelte-2r6tp5{width:0;height:0;display:none!important}.absolute.svelte-2r6tp5{position:absolute}button.svelte-2r6tp5{background-color:var(--color-black);border:solid .5px var(--color-white);width:30%;color:var(--color-white);z-index:20;cursor:pointer;border-bottom:#0000;border-radius:2px;padding:.4rem;transition:all .3s ease-in-out;position:relative}button.svelte-2r6tp5:after{content:"";z-index:-1;opacity:1;background:linear-gradient(65deg, var(--border-color) 0%, var(--border-color) 100%, #ffd10000 100%);border-radius:0 0 2px 2px;width:100%;height:10%;transition:all .3s ease-in-out;position:absolute;bottom:0;left:0%;right:0}button.svelte-2r6tp5:hover:after{border-radius:2px;height:100%}button.svelte-2r6tp5:hover{color:var(--text-hover-color);border:none;transition:all .3s ease-in-out}.button-content.svelte-2r6tp5{text-transform:uppercase;letter-spacing:.6px;margin:auto;font-family:IBM Plex Mono,sans-serif;font-size:.6rem;font-weight:500}@media (width>=55em){section.svelte-2r6tp5{width:100%;margin:3rem auto}button.svelte-2r6tp5{width:20%}form.svelte-2r6tp5{width:100%}.container.svelte-2r6tp5{width:80%}.button-content.svelte-2r6tp5{font-size:.7rem}.message.svelte-2r6tp5{padding-bottom:10rem}}@media (width>=75em){section.svelte-2r6tp5{width:100%;margin:3rem auto}}section.svelte-1dvp4sj{color:var(--color-white);transition:all 1s cubic-bezier(.07,.95,0,1);position:relative}h2.svelte-1dvp4sj{margin-bottom:2rem}.imprint-link.svelte-1dvp4sj{margin-bottom:2rem;margin-left:auto}.description.svelte-1dvp4sj{width:100%}.description.svelte-1dvp4sj>:where(.svelte-1dvp4sj)+:where(.svelte-1dvp4sj){margin-top:1rem}#underline.svelte-1dvp4sj{z-index:20;font-size:1.1rem;position:relative}#underline.svelte-1dvp4sj:after{content:"";z-index:-1;opacity:.5;background:linear-gradient(65deg, var(--color-secondary) 0%, var(--color-secondary) 100%, #ffd10000 100%);border-radius:2px;width:102%;height:30%;transition:all .2s ease-in-out;position:absolute;bottom:10%;left:-1%}#underline.svelte-1dvp4sj:hover:after{height:80%}@media (width>=55em){h2.svelte-1dvp4sj{margin-bottom:3rem}#underline.svelte-1dvp4sj{font-size:1.2rem}.description.svelte-1dvp4sj{width:66%;margin-top:2rem}.imprint-link.svelte-1dvp4sj{margin-bottom:4rem}}.figures.svelte-1r63dor{flex-direction:row;justify-content:space-between;gap:2rem;width:100%;display:none}.website.svelte-1r63dor,.chart.svelte-1r63dor{background-color:var(--color-black);z-index:auto;border-radius:12px;width:30%;height:auto;padding:.5rem;position:relative}.chart.svelte-1r63dor:before,.website.svelte-1r63dor:before{content:"";opacity:.5;border:2px solid var(--color-primary);box-sizing:border-box;border-radius:12px;width:100%;height:100%;display:block;position:absolute;top:0;left:0;transform:translate(-.3rem,-.5rem)}@media (width>=55em){.figures.svelte-1r63dor{margin-left:auto;display:flex}.website.svelte-1r63dor{width:30%;margin-top:8rem;padding:2rem}.chart.svelte-1r63dor{width:30%;margin-bottom:8rem;padding:2rem}.chart.svelte-1r63dor:before,.website.svelte-1r63dor:before{transform:translate(1rem,-1rem)}}#usp.svelte-1i24wfv{background-color:var(--color-gray)}h2.svelte-1i24wfv{color:var(--color-primary);margin-bottom:2rem}section.svelte-1i24wfv{color:var(--color-white);transition:all 1s cubic-bezier(.07,.95,0,1);position:relative}.description.svelte-1i24wfv>:where(.svelte-1i24wfv)+:where(.svelte-1i24wfv){margin-top:1rem}.grid.svelte-1i24wfv{grid-template-columns:1fr;align-items:center;gap:3rem;display:grid}.description.svelte-1i24wfv{margin:auto 0}@media (width>=55em){h2.svelte-1i24wfv{margin-bottom:3rem}.grid.svelte-1i24wfv{grid-template-columns:1fr 1fr;gap:4rem}}.background.svelte-1uha8ag{z-index:-1;background:linear-gradient(90deg,#14151d,#14151d);flex-grow:1;width:100%;height:100%;display:flex;position:absolute;top:0;left:0;overflow:hidden}.background.svelte-1uha8ag div:where(.svelte-1uha8ag){filter:blur(240vw);opacity:.04;border-radius:100%;height:0;position:absolute}.background.svelte-1uha8ag div:where(.svelte-1uha8ag):first-child{background:linear-gradient(132deg, var(--color-primary) 0%, var(--color-secondary) 100%);width:50%;padding-top:47%;top:40%;left:10%;transform:translate(-50%)translateY(-50%)}.background.svelte-1uha8ag div:where(.svelte-1uha8ag):nth-child(2){background:linear-gradient(45deg, var(--color-secondary) 0%, var(--color-secondary) 100%);width:57%;padding-top:57%;top:90%;left:88%;transform:translate(-50%)translateY(-50%)}
